Golden Knights Sink Pitt-Johnstown With Hot 3-Point Shooting, Clutch Plays Late (Photo Gallery)

THE RUNDOWN
  • Final Score: Gannon 64, Pitt-Johnstown 61
  • Records: Gannon (4-10, 2-6 PSAC) | Pitt-Johnstown (9-5, 4-3 PSAC)
  • Location: Hammermill Center — Erie, Pa.

KEY SEQUENCE
  • Pitt-Johnstown reeled off a 10-point run to jump back in the game at 61-59 with 2:08 remaining. Daryl Porter (Southfield, Mich./Walled Lake Western) bounced back from an offensive foul on the next possession to rise and hit a jumper from the right elbow with 1:10 to play, but the Mountain Cats again pulled to within two on a layup. With the guests looking to make a defensive stop and have the ball with a chance to win, Porter pulled in a huge offensive rebound with five seconds left, ran the ball out to burn time, and hit a free throw with 0.4 on the clock to preserve the victory.
 
HOW IT HAPPENED
  • The Mountain Cats got on the board with a jumper early, and got plenty of chances with offense rebounds, but Joe Fustine (Erie, Pa./Cathedral Prep) was still able to tie it at 2-2 with a layup nearly four minutes in. UPJ did manage to go up with the next two baskets, but a 10-0 burst from the Golden Knights – with Fustine hitting two straight 3-pointers and Matt Johnson (Chicago, Ill./Adlai E. Stevenson) adding another – flipped the script and made it 12-6 with 13:16 on the clock.
  • A fastbreak dunk and triple tied it up for the Cats, but Gannon stayed hot from beyond the arc, with Porter and Victor Olawoye (Elmont, N.Y./Elmont Memorial) hitting to make it 22-16. With another Olawoye trey and a slick layup from Kevin Dodds (Downingtown, Pa./Bishop Shanahan) helping to open up a 29-24 advantage for the hosts heading into the locker room.
  • UPJ forced a turnover early in the second half, starting a quick run that tied the game up at 29-all just over two minutes into the period. Kevin Dodds (Downingtown, Pa./Bishop Shanahan) drew a big charge on the defensive end the next trip up the court, and converted on the offensive end to halt that momentum and start a back-and-forth stretch.
  • The lead changed hands three times before Olawoye hit a trey to tie it up, then laid one in to make it 38-36 at the 12:51 mark. Mike Haysbert (Baltimore, Md./Western School of Technology and Environmental Science) pulled in an offensive rebound to keep things alive for a Porter 3-pointer, and on the next possession, Porter followed his own miss and converted on a stick-back to put the Knights up 43-36 and force a UPJ timeout with 11:51 left.
  • A three-point play by Jonathan Harewood (Baldwin, N.Y./St. Anthony's) gave Gannon its biggest lead of the game at 52-40 and finished off a 19-4 run with 8:32 on the clock. Another Olawoye 3 pushed the lead back to 10, and the freshman swiped a pass to start a fastbreak that ended in a pair of free throws to push it back to double digits.
  • Haysbert was big on the glass again with just over five minutes to play, pulling in an offensive board and going back up for the basket, and getting fouled on a defensive rebound to reach the foul line. His free throws made it 61-49 with 4:59 to play, but the Mountain Cats used turnovers and foul shots to creep back into it with their 10-0 run before the clutch plays late sealed the win for the Golden Knights.
     
GAME NOTES
  • Olawoye led Gannon with 22 points on 7-of-14 shooting, including five 3-pointers. The freshman was 3-of-5 from deep in the first half, hitting three big 3-pointers late in the period to help the Knights head to the locker room up 29-24.
  • In addition to his late-game plays, Porter finished with 15 points, seven rebounds and two assists. That's double digits in scoring in seven of the past 10 games, and back-to-back 15-point efforts.
  • Haysbert's four points all came in a 28-second span with less than six minutes to play. He also turned in eight rebounds, including five offensive boards that helped Gannon collect 23 offensive rebounds and 22 second-chance points.
  • Fustine turned in back-to-back double-digit scoring games for the first time in his career, hitting a pair of 3-pointers on the way to 10 points to go with a team-high nine rebounds and two steals.
  • Pitt-Johnstown entered the game 10th in the nation with a 51.3 shooting percentage. The Golden Knights held the Cats to just 38.6 percent (17-of-44), their least made field goals in a game this season and lowest shooting percentage since the season opener.
  • Gannon was 12-of-15 (80.0 percent) at the free throw line. It's the second straight game the Knights have shot at least 80 percent in a game after not shooting better than 70 percent from the line in their first 12 games.
  • The 10 made 3-pointers by the Golden Knights is the most since also hitting 10 against Kutztown in the PSAC semifinals March 4, 2017.
